What I Remember
Just about every minor league team today has unusual nickname, there are Yard Goats, Jumbo Shrimp and Trash Pandas all vying for a larger slice of the increasing memorabilia pie. But in 1991 most minor league teams used their parent club’s name, the Carolina Mudcats being a notable and successful exception.
From the start, everyone wanted a Mudcats hat and the team gifted us with one for each of us the night we were there. Unfortunately the team’s new park, Five County Stadium in Zebulon, NC was still a few weeks from ready to open. That gave us, however, a chance to see a game at lovely old Fleming Stadium in Wilson, the next town over. You will get a full rundown on some of that park’s history in the video below.
